Controls in detail Retractable hardtop Rear window defroster G Warning! Any accumulation of snow and ice should be removed from the rear window before driving. Visibility could otherwise be impaired, endangering you and others. The rear window defroster uses a large amount of power. To keep the battery drain to a minimum, switch off the defroster as soon as the rear window is clear. The defroster is automatically switched off after some time of operation depending on the outside temperature. X Switch on the ignition. X ! If the rear window defroster switches off too soon and the indicator lamp starts flashing, too many electrical consumers are operating simultaneously and there is insufficient voltage in the battery. The system responds automatically by switching the rear window defroster off. As soon as the battery has sufficient voltage, the rear window defroster switches back on automatically. To prevent possible accidents, only drive the vehicle with the retractable hardtop either completely closed and locked, or fully lowered into its storage compartment. If the retractable hardtop does not completely open or close, the roof hydraulics will lose pressure and the retractable hardtop is lowered Rafter approximately 7 minutes when the ignition is switched on Rafter approximately 15 seconds when the ignition is switched off Shortly before the retractable hardtop is lowered, a warning will sound.
